How is Absence from work defined in a legal contract?

  • Absence from work means unauthorized absence from the workplace, including late attendance or leaving the workplace early without permission, whether expressed verbally or in written form. Seen in 3 SEC filings.
  • Absence from work means unauthorized departure from the workplace, being late, or leaving the workplace early without explicit approval. Seen in 3 SEC filings.
  • Absence from work means unauthorized absence from the workplace, including coming late or leaving early. Seen in 1 SEC filing.
  • Absence from work means unauthorized absence from the workplace, tardiness, or leaving the workplace early without permission. Seen in 1 SEC filing.
